Emma Gause is a scholar working on Health, Clinical Psychology and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health. According to data from OpenAlex, Emma Gause has authored 38 papers receiving a total of 223 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 19 papers in Health, 15 papers in Clinical Psychology and 11 papers in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health. Recurrent topics in Emma Gause’s work include Gun Ownership and Violence Research (18 papers), Suicide and Self-Harm Studies (15 papers) and Injury Epidemiology and Prevention (9 papers). Emma Gause is often cited by papers focused on Gun Ownership and Violence Research (18 papers), Suicide and Self-Harm Studies (15 papers) and Injury Epidemiology and Prevention (9 papers). Emma Gause collaborates with scholars based in United States, Canada and United Kingdom. Emma Gause's co-authors include Ali Rowhani‐Rahbar, Frederick P. Rivara, Vivian H. Lyons, Brianna Mills, Jonathan Jay, Miriam J. Haviland, Anthony S. Floyd, Julia P. Schleimer, Sabrina Oesterle and Barclay T. Stewart and has published in prestigious journals such as Annals of Internal Medicine, PLoS ONE and American Journal of Epidemiology.
